Transaction 3f406ae151338a4bae41ad9a6774de4c790234dc71cf9c753694d1261f82c787

1 Input
2 Outputs
  • 3f406ae151338a4bae41ad9a6774de4c790234dc71cf9c753694d1261f82c787:0
  • value  398045
    address  3E8EUSnh15Y1r6ShFb6WuSbNe8UWNKEck5
  • 3f406ae151338a4bae41ad9a6774de4c790234dc71cf9c753694d1261f82c787:1
  • value  22264247
    address  3HJgLQvcrMh8a2ot9cCyS4k8Vxj6HxPqh1